Output ebc107a8e1796f8a350afdea8ae57fffc857f2fbd6ba2ad96c1908bdf26d3ed6:1

value
368627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eedfe83b9dd79f7cc322a828aa0f6edf4f193fb OP_EQUAL
address
38tMjdgZJLQmka4NaMkV8uA8dqaKHVxrcG
transaction
ebc107a8e1796f8a350afdea8ae57fffc857f2fbd6ba2ad96c1908bdf26d3ed6
confirmations
377166
spent
true